Cost

The cost of replacing a hyundai key bexley key varies greatly depending on the car model and the location where it's replaced and if it's a smart key. It's generally more expensive to replace an remote or electronic key compared to a traditional one. It is also more expensive to replace the ignition cylinder than just a key.

You can purchase a Hyundai key fob at the dealership or a locksmith. It's important to keep in mind that the key fob may need to be programmed to allow the new key to work. This process will require the dealer to have access to your VIN and other documents.

Most modern Hyundai cars have transponder chips embedded in their keys which recognizes the owner of the car. This is a safety feature to guard against theft. This is a great feature, but it could be problematic if you lose your keys.

Dealerships

2010 hyundai santa fe key fob has introduced new technology into their automobiles in the form a digital key. This system offers drivers the convenience of unlocking their vehicle, and then launching it with a smartphone application. The cost of this method is a lot higher than a standard chip key, and is also more difficult to duplicate. However, it is important to remember that it is possible to obtain an replacement key from the dealer If you have roadside assist coverage.

If you're in a crisis and need a new Hyundai key, you must always contact an auto locksmith who is familiar with Hyundai models. They will be able to supply you with a brand new key quickly and at a fair price. A professional mobile locksmith should be able to complete remote fob programming when needed.

You can visit a dealership for a new key however, you'll likely pay more than if you went to an automotive locksmith. You'll also have to bring proof of ownership and ID to the dealership. It is also essential to note that the dealer will have to program the new key and match it to the computer system in your car. This process could take a few days.
